Search documentation...

K

CleverTap

Build better campaigns on CleverTap with up-to-date customer data from your data warehouse

Setup

Navigate to Setting > Project in CleverTap to view credentials.
From the Project tab, copy Project Id as Account Id and Passcode into Hightouch. Use CleverTap Region for Localization.

Supported Types

Hightouch supports syncing to the following CleverTap types:
  • Objects
  • Events

Syncing Objects

Hightouch supports syncing to the following CleverTap objects:
  • Profile Hightouch allows you to sync user profiles from a source into CleverTap.

Sync Modes

  • Upsert - In upsert mode, Hightouchs adds new rows and keeps existing rows up to date.

Record Matching

For each user profile, a user identifier is required. This is the key that CleverTap uses to find the user whose profile needs to be updated. You have to set a value for one of these parameters to identify the user: Identity, CleverTap Global Object ID, Facebook ID or Google Plus ID. If this identity is not found a new user profile will be created.
You may also provide additional identifiers through Field Mapping. Profiles are automatically unified by CleverTap.

Field Mapping

You can sync columns from your source to CleverTap.
CleverTap highly recommends you provide common fields like Name, Email, Phone, etc.. You can see additional details here.
Phone numbers must be formatted as +[country code][phone number] (ie. +14155551234). CleverTap will reject rows that are not in this format.
Additional fields that fits your unique use case can be mapped through custom mappings.
CleverTap automatically generates schema for custom fields you provide. You can see existing schemas by navigating to Setting > Schema > User Properties in CleverTap.

Syncing Events

Event Name

You can provide a fixed event name or use a value from your source as event name by toggling the switch button.
New event names are automatically added to CleverTap schema.

Record Matching

For each event, a user identifier is required. This is the key that CleverTap uses to find the user whose profile needs to be updated. You have to set a value for one of these parameters to identify the user: Identity, CleverTap Global Object ID, Facebook ID or Google Plus ID. If this identity is not found a new user profile will be created.

Field Mapping

You can sync any column from your source to into any event field in CleverTap.
CleverTap automatically generates schema for custom fields you provide. You can see generated and existing schemas by navigating to Setting > Schema > Events in CleverTap.

    Need help?

    Our team is relentlessly focused on your success. We're ready to jump on a call to help unblock you.

    • Connection issues with your data warehouse?
    • Confusing API responses from destination systems?
    • Unsupported destination objects or modes?
    • Help with complex SQL queries?

    or

    Feature Requests?

    If you see something that's missing from our app, let us know and we'll work with you to build it!

    We want to hear your suggestions for new sources, destinations, and other features that would help you activate your data.

On this page

SetupSupported TypesSyncing ObjectsSync ModesRecord MatchingField MappingSyncing EventsEvent NameRecord MatchingField Mapping

Was this page helpful?